What to Eat

Amman has a variety of culinary offerings, including traditional Jordanian dishes and international cuisine. Some of the most popular dishes include:

  • Mansaf: A traditional Jordanian dish made with lamb, rice, and a yogurt sauce.
  • Maqluba: A layered dish made with rice, vegetables, and meat.
  • Falafel: Fried chickpea balls.
  • Shawarma: Grilled meat wrapped in a pita bread.
  • Kanafeh: A sweet pastry made with shredded filo dough, nuts, and syrup.

Where to Go

There are a number of places to visit in Amman, including:

  • Amman Citadel: A hilltop fortress that offers panoramic views of the city.
  • Roman Amphitheater: A 2nd-century Roman amphitheater that is still used for performances today.
  • Jordan Museum: A museum that houses a collection of artifacts from Jordan's history and culture.
  • King Abdullah Mosque: A modern mosque that is one of the largest in the world.
  • Rainbow Street: A vibrant street lined with shops, restaurants, and cafes.
